Java中的条件语句是基于条件判断的控制结构,用于根据不同的条件执行不同的代码块。
条件语句的原理是通过判断一个条件表达式的真假来决定是否执行特定的代码块。条件表达式通常使用关系运算符(如等于、不等于、大于、小于等)和逻辑运算符(如AND、OR、NOT等)来构建。条件表达式的结果必须是一个布尔值,即true或false。
Java中常用的条件语句有if语句、if-else语句、if-else if-else语句和switch语句。
if (条件表达式) {
// 执行代码块
}
if (条件表达式) {
// 执行if代码块
} else {
// 执行else代码块
}
if (条件表达式1) {
// 执行代码块1
} else if (条件表达式2) {
// 执行代码块2
} else {
// 执行代码块3
}
switch (表达式) {
case 常量值1:
// 执行代码块1
break;
case 常量值2:
// 执行代码块2
break;
// ...
default:
// 执行默认代码块
}
条件语句使得程序能够根据不同的条件执行不同的逻辑,从而实现更灵活和多样化的程序控制。